Okay...I need to solve a dispute. My dad insists that people rake leaves in Florida...my mom insists that they don't have very many deciduous trees (like maple, oak, and kind that drops leaves) in Florida, and so, they don't rake. So do you rake...?

Yes, we rake, but we do it year round! :lol: Seriously, I have a camphor tree that is either dropping leaves, or these little hard berries that hurt like heck if you step on them in bare feet. The Magnolia trees also drop HUGE leaves, and "fruit" that really hurts when it hits you. The acorns have also been awful this year.

However, most people don't rake. They have the "mow, blow, and go" yard guys come by. Unfortunately, he blows the leaves into the flower beds, so I still have to "rake" them. :lol:
